Description:  A CN train approaches Kampo Rd. as it heads southwest via former SOO rails at Neenah, WI, on 2 Aug. '25. Train, with a friendly engineer, had four locomotives, CN 3154, CN 3220 and CN 8305 pulling as well as CN 3213 mid-train. Neenah Foundry Plant 2 & Plant 3 can be seen in the background to the right. Plant 2 opened in 1960 and Plant 3 was built in 1967. Plant 1 opened in 1918 and stood about a mile to the north, until it was closed in 1994 and eventually demolished. A remnant of the former C&NW main line, now relegated to a passing siding, runs parallel to the right.
